What form of energy is in a moving car?

  1. Mechanical
  2. Electrical
  3. Light
  4. Sound

Hint:

Mechanical

The correct answer is: Mechanical


    A moving car possess mechanical energy due to its motion which is also called Kinetic energy. Kinetic energy is possessed due to the motion or movement of an object. Here as the car is moving, it possesses kinetic energy due to its motion.
